[628. The truth is revealed!]

After thousands of years of oral transmission, refinement and exaggeration, it has been incorporated into myths and legends.

All that existed as far back as the origin of the Earth still exists today. What happened on this planet millions of years ago still exists in another time and space.

What will happen millions of years from now has already happened.

Reincarnation and fate go hand in hand forever. Even if this universe is destroyed and a new universe is born, it will still happen.

They were born in the era before humans. No one knows their purpose, and it is impossible to verify what era they were ancient creatures.

“Oh, Igos -“

At this moment, Zhuge Yun finally understood that the culprit who made Lin Wenlai look like this was not the ancient god Itaka, but Yi, who was known as the god of blindness and ignorance. Goss.

The Obsidian Society apparently took advantage of the opportunity to modulate Lin Wenlai’s body and used Igos’s genes as a mutation inducer to turn him into a 12-column hound in order to control him and serve them.

Although it was impossible to restore Lin Wenlai’s mutated body and become a normal human again, it would not be difficult for Zhuge Yun to know what was controlling his consciousness and then release this control.

In Zhuge Yun’s understanding, the spiritual energy of the ancient Old Ones is divided into many levels.

At least it can make lower creatures lose their minds, interfere with their thinking, and become their spiritual slaves. At worst, it can affect the operating power and even the laws of the universe.

Moreover, the strength of the gods is also different. Among the many ancient rulers of the past, Igos’s ability is considered to be above average, but it is not yet at the highest level.

Zhuge Yun is very confident and can prescribe the right medicine before their true consciousness has awakened. This is difficult for others, but it couldn’t be easier for him.

Lin Wenlai can still be saved!

Under Zhuge Yun’s control, Lin Wenlai did not have to risk burning his life force and having his body reconditioned.

Although his excessive metabolism was torturing him, devouring his body cells, exhausting his energy and causing him to die, he could change the status quo and escape from this control.

Because he has a way to reverse all this.

Zhuge Yun can completely absorb the power of these ancient gods, neutralize the dark energy, and transform it into his own spiritual power.

Think about it, this is the energy of a god!

Different from the previous time when he rescued Long Yuantian in the Arctic underground, this time, Zhuge Yun not only had to confront Igos on the spiritual level, but also directly absorbed the essence cells of the old rulers on the material level.

What a terrifying thing it would be to get this kind of power, and it’s something only he can do.

At this moment, a smile appeared on Zhuge Yun’s cold face.

This is a greedy smile.

Gu Feiyan looked at the cold and arrogant face of the black-haired young man, and there was a hint of smile, and she couldn’t help but feel puzzled.

He did not shy away from the price he had to pay after doing all this.

It’s nothing more than contributing a little energy to the huge existence in his body. He doesn’t have to care about other people’s opinions, for example, whether the servants will treat him as a monster.

No matter what, he wanted to get that power. In this way, he not only saved Lin Wenlai, but also improved his spiritual power level.

Joyner was in this situation at the beginning, and he also turned the situation around.

The extremely huge shadow in Zhuge Yun’s body, which is unbearably hungry, is the natural enemy of these old rulers. A more ancient high-level god lives in his body.

Use the power of the “Star-Gathering Phantom Seal” to absorb the power of the old rulers.

No one knows this secret except himself.

“But Xiao Wu…”

Zhuge Yun suddenly thought of Xiao Wu, was she also controlled by the power of Eggos?

There are many suspicious things about this matter, and even Zhuge Yun is a little unsure.

At this moment, Gu Feiyan felt a little scared when she saw Zhuge Yun’s uncertain face.

“Do you, do you have anything else to ask?” She wanted to leave quickly, her eyes were dull and she stammered.

Anyone could see that her will had been shaken.

Even she felt that her spirit was about to collapse. Her suppressed spirit was restless, fear kept appearing, and her body was shaking involuntarily.

This was a feeling she had never had when fighting against Joyner and other strong men. In her subconscious, she even felt that Zhuge Yun was also an inexplicable super being.

Facing Zhuge Yun, she had never felt such a tremor from the bottom of her heart.

This man is so terrifying, he seems to be able to kill himself with just his eyes!

“Then -” a faint voice came. “Tell me everything you know. Don’t hide anything. Also tell me your plans, especially about Xiao Wu.”

“Xiao Wu? Who is Xiao Wu?”

“Don’t you know?”

Gu Fei Yan felt the cold light as sharp as a thorn, and trembled all over again.

Hearing Zhuge Yun’s rhetorical question, Gu Feiyan struggled in her heart, fearing that if she said something wrong, the young man’s terrible punishment would befall her.

“Ah, by the way, could it be her?” Gu Feiyan’s mind was spinning rapidly, and she quickly thought of the pure white girl. This question made it difficult for her to answer: “This is… well, I only know her name is Wu. Ji was personally brought by the organization’s top management. The top management didn’t disclose her situation to me, so I know nothing about other things. Oh, by the way, she is also one of the new 12-pillar hounds.”

Gu Feiyan looked uneasy and did not dare to look at Zhuge Yun’s cold face.

“I don’t know anything -” Zhuge Yun’s expression changed slightly. “You really don’t know?”

“Yes, yes… that is a higher-level secret. I have a low status in the organization and it is impossible to have access to it.” Gu Feiyan said tremblingly.

“Humph——” Zhuge Yun said softly and turned his back.

So his consciousness scanned Gu Feiyan’s body and noticed that when she said these words, her heartbeat and pulse changes were within the acceptable range, indicating that these should be the truth.

He expected that this woman wouldn’t have the guts to lie to him.

This situation is somewhat unexpected.

Something was fishy. Zhuge Yun frowned and lowered his head, deep in thought.

After a while, he finally raised his head, stared at Gu Feiyan and said, “Okay, then, what other secrets are there? Tell me what you know.”

Gu Feiyan did not dare to hide it, Plan Ark, Plan Isaac and the Silver Key Sacred Artifact, almost all the information she had access to was told at once.

Of course, this was only part of the Obsidian Society’s plan, and there was more that she could not understand.

“Well, Ark – Libea? What is this thing…” Zhuge Yun had a trace of uneasiness in his eyes.

The Obsidian Society actually has a super huge biological battleship? This was the first time he heard of it.

“By the way, Master, there’s something I almost forgot to tell you.” Joyner suddenly interrupted.

“Tell me.”

She recounted what she saw on the sea that day.

Memories kept hitting Joyner’s mind and heart, letting them flow through her heart.

Although she didn’t know what it was at the time, when she heard Gu Feiyan speak, she suddenly remembered that the thing must be the Ark.

“Oh, interesting.” Zhuge Yun looked at Gu Feiyan and said, “What is the purpose of building that thing?”

“I am not very clear about the purpose of the organization. I am only responsible for organizing and implementing the launch of the Ark, and I also know how to float it. , it requires the energy of a 12-pillar hound, and I know very little about other things.”

Zhuge Yun narrowed his eyes and thought about it, why?

The Obsidian Society wants to build a biological giant ship – the Ark.

He suddenly thought of something. It was unclear whether the cause and effect of these things were related to the Ark, but the results and creations were obviously related to the life form he was thinking of.

That is, what was the Ark made of?

When he first arrived on Earth, he and Xiao Wu saw the huge jellyfish-like life form in the ruins deep underground.

He knew that those jellyfish were spacecraft left behind by civilizations that had brought countless fires of life in ancient times at least hundreds of millions of years ago. It was itself a living creature, sleeping deep in the mantle for many centuries.

Their larvae, known as “s” life forms, have extraordinary perception and strong vitality, originating from distant unknown galaxies. Zhuge Yun has seen this incredible life in places where other life cannot survive.

Even in the huge black holes after the destruction of stars, they can absorb energy and evolve themselves into many different forms.

Based on this calculation, there must still be such creatures in other places on the earth. But after so much time, he didn’t know what kind of existence this creature would eventually evolve into. In short, he felt that the Ark was inseparably connected with this “s” life form.

Zhuge Yun remembered: above the ruins where the giant life forms were discovered, there was a military base left by humans. This showed that humans at that time were already aware of the existence of these super life forms.

“Huh?”

Zhuge Yun felt that someone was staring at him from behind, so he glanced behind him with his consciousness, and sure enough he found Su Zhe frowning at him, silent.

Zhuge Yun knew why Su Zhe was looking at him at this time. He knew that Su Zhe was the general manager of the former civilization’s “Titan Project” and had been studying those creatures for a long time.

Gu Feiyan’s words must have reminded him of something or made him feel deeply.

“So, when did you start building the ark?” Zhuge Yun said coldly.

“That was too long ago. I don’t know the specific time. Maybe the organization started this plan before I was born.”

Zhuge Yun nodded, thinking that maybe Xiao Wu was on that ark.

Since Xiao Wu himself is a secret that can only be accessed by the senior leaders of the Obsidian Society, in that case, he must go and take a trip.

Go to the Ark!
